Donald R. Bryan

July 3, 1948 — February 23, 2016

Donald R. Bryan, 67, of Moline, Illinois, died unexpectedly on Tuesday, February 23, 2016, at University Hospitals, Iowa City, Iowa.

Services are 10:30 a.m. Monday in the Horizon Room at Trimble Funeral Home at Trimble Pointe, 701 12th Street, Moline, with The Reverend Larry Conway officiating. Cremation will take place at Trimble Crematory and burial is in Rock Island National Cemetery, where Moline American Legion Post #246, will present military honors. Visitation is 2 to 5 p.m. Sunday at the funeral home. In lieu of flowers, memorials may be made to Honor Flight of the Quad Cities.

Donald Ray Bryan was born in Princeton, Missouri, to Buford and Helen (Snyder) Bryan. He married Vicki Miles on July 26, 1969, in Washington, Iowa. He served in the U. S. Army's 25th Infantry Division in Vietnam. He then served 18 years in the Iowa National Guard with the HHC 65th Engr. BN, and later in the Army Reserves. He owned and operated Bryan Tap Cleaning Service for 20 years, and also worked for John Deere, American Air Filter, and Walmart.

Don loved his God and his country, and was a life member of the VFW, past president of the Moline American Legion, and a member of the Milan American Legion, Silvis Frateral Order of Eagles, and Vietnam Veterans of America. In addition to being a good husband, father, grandfather, and friend to many, Don was a story teller and jokester, who loved to make people laugh. Growing up on the family farm, he was a handyman and woodworker. He was a Civil War buff and reader, and an avid St. Louis Cardinals fan.

Don is survived by his wife, Vicki; two daughters, Teri Guertler and her husband Tom, and Cindy Bryan and her fiancé Chris Comp; six grandchildren, Hannah, Reagan, and Owen Guertler, and Bryan, Elizabeth, and Emily Comp; a great-granddaughter, Ashlynn VenHorst; a brother and two sisters-in-law, Ronald and Cheri Bryan of Princeton, Missouri, and Jo Ann Bryan of Aurora, Colorado; and his best buddy, Joe Masa of Guam. He was preceded in death by his parents and brother, Larry Bryan.
